To multiply binomials, use the FOIL method. Which of the following is not a part of the FOIL method?

83% Answer Correctly

First

Last

Odd

Inside


Solution

To multiply binomials, use the FOIL method. FOIL stands for First, Outside, Inside, Last and refers to the position of each term in the parentheses.

The formula for the area of a circle is which of the following?

77% Answer Correctly

a = π r2

a = π d2

a = π r

a = π d


Solution

The circumference of a circle is the distance around its perimeter and equals π (approx. 3.14159) x diameter: c = π d. The area of a circle is π x (radius)2 : a = π r2.

The endpoints of this line segment are at (-2, -4) and (2, -2). What is the slope-intercept equation for this line?

41% Answer Correctly
y = 3x - 2
y = \(\frac{1}{2}\)x + 4
y = 3x - 4
y = \(\frac{1}{2}\)x - 3

Solution

The slope-intercept equation for a line is y = mx + b where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ept of the line. From the graph, you can see that the y-intercept (the y-value from the point where the line crosses the y-axis) is -3. The slope of this line is the change in y divided by the change in x. The endpoints of this line segment are at (-2, -4) and (2, -2) so the slope becomes:

m = \( \frac{\Delta y}{\Delta x} \) = \( \frac{(-2.0) - (-4.0)}{(2) - (-2)} \) = \( \frac{2}{4} \)
m = \(\frac{1}{2}\)

Plugging these values into the slope-intercept equation:

y = \(\frac{1}{2}\)x - 3

The endpoints of this line segment are at (-2, 6) and (2, 2). What is the slope of this line?

46% Answer Correctly
-2
1\(\frac{1}{2}\)
-1
1

Solution

The slope of this line is the change in y divided by the change in x. The endpoints of this line segment are at (-2, 6) and (2, 2) so the slope becomes:

m = \( \frac{\Delta y}{\Delta x} \) = \( \frac{(2.0) - (6.0)}{(2) - (-2)} \) = \( \frac{-4}{4} \)
m = -1
